How do you turn on the parking sensor on a Toyota Corolla?

To turn on the parking sensor on a Toyota Corolla, follow these steps:
1. Start the car and put it in “Park” or “Neutral” mode.
2. Locate the parking sensor button or switch. The exact location may vary depending on the model year and trim level of your Toyota Corolla. It is usually located on the center console or dashboard.
3. Press the parking sensor button or switch to turn it on. Once activated, the parking sensors will start detecting objects around the vehicle and provide alerts to the driver.
4. The parking sensors typically emit a beeping noise within the cabin, which increases in frequency as the car gets closer to an object. Some Toyota Corollas also have a visual display on the dashboard showing which corner of the car is causing the beeps.
5. If your Toyota Corolla did not come with parking sensors when it rolled out of the factory, you may consider having an aftermarket parking sensor system installed. Consult a professional or refer to the owner’s manual for more information on installation options.
Please note that the availability and functionality of parking sensors may vary depending on the specific model year and trim level of your Toyota Corolla. It is always recommended to consult the owner’s manual for detailed instructions specific to your vehicle.

Why doesn t my park assist work?

If the feature still isn’t working, make sure all the feature’s ultrasonic sensors are clean and aren’t covered by anything. The feature uses 12 sensors located on the front and rear bumpers that look like small, circular indentations. The feature won’t work properly if they are dirty or obstructed.

Why is my parking sensor off?

The sensor may mistake dirt for a close object, therefore setting the sensors off incorrectly. So, it’s important to keep your parking sensors clean to ensure they are working as they should be. Cleaning your side and rear parking sensors is a pretty simple task.
